Output 56cac2ea4f32ed552059832b3ea17ac71b7308e1d45aaed66aab2e6c4693161d:18

value
110460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c7fc802c02bb71b9a4b348e41f9e701ab9748d4 OP_EQUAL
address
3EVuboLscZ2YP7atvfk7y1daM6AhSQkUhp
transaction
56cac2ea4f32ed552059832b3ea17ac71b7308e1d45aaed66aab2e6c4693161d
confirmations
279962
spent
true